Programmers and developer teams are coding and developing software.
Learning

Describing the components of a VMware Cloud solution and VMware SDDC

This blog was originally written by Frazier Smith and published on the VFrazier blog

In this post, we will be diving into the details of three key components that make up a VMware Cloud solution: vSphere, NSX, and vSAN. These powerful tools work together to provide a comprehensive and robust virtualization platform for businesses of all sizes.

We will be discussing the features and capabilities of each component, as well as how they interact with one another to create a seamless and efficient virtual infrastructure.

Whether you’re a seasoned IT professional or just getting started with virtualization, this post will provide valuable insights into the inner workings of a VMware Cloud solution.


vSphere

vSphere is a virtualization platform from VMware that allows users to create and manage virtual machines (VMs) on a single physical host. This platform is designed to increase efficiency, reduce costs, and improve disaster recovery capabilities.

One of the key features of vSphere is the ability to create and manage VMs. Users can create new VMs from scratch or clone existing ones, and configure them with different CPU, memory, and storage resources. vSphere also allows users to manage the life cycle of VMs, including the ability to power them on, off, or suspend them, as well as take snapshots of their current state.

Another important feature of vSphere is its ability to manage and allocate resources to VMs. vSphere allows users to create resource pools, which can be used to assign CPU and memory resources to VMs. Users can also use vSphere to manage storage resources, including the ability to create and manage storage clusters, and assign storage to VMs.

vSphere also includes a number of advanced features that allow users to improve the availability, scalability, and performance of their virtual infrastructure. These include features such as high availability, which allows VMs to be automatically restarted on another host in the event of a failure, and Distributed Resource Scheduler (DRS), which automatically balances resources among VMs to ensure optimal performance.

In addition to these features, vSphere also includes a number of management and monitoring tools that allow users to manage and monitor their virtual infrastructure. These tools include vCenter Server, which provides a centralized management console for vSphere, and vSphere Web Client, which provides a web-based interface for managing vSphere.

Overall, vSphere is a powerful and feature-rich virtualization platform that allows users to create and manage virtual machines, allocate resources, and improve the availability, scalability, and performance of their virtual infrastructure. With its advanced features and management tools, vSphere is an essential tool for any organization looking to improve their virtualization capabilities.

vSphere is the backbone of VMware Cloud and provides the foundation for virtualization. It allows businesses to create and manage virtual machines, as well as access to a wide range of tools and features that make it easy to manage and scale their IT infrastructure. With vSphere, businesses can easily create and manage virtual networks, storage, and security policies, as well as automate tasks and monitor performance.


NSX

Our second foundational component for VMware Cloud solutions is NSX. NSX is a network virtualization platform from VMware that allows users to create and manage virtual networks on top of existing physical infrastructure. This platform is designed to provide a flexible and efficient way to manage and secure networks in a virtualized environment.

One of the key features of NSX is the ability to create and manage virtual networks. Users can create multiple virtual networks, also known as logical networks, that can be isolated from each other, yet still share the same physical infrastructure. These virtual networks can be configured with different network services, such as firewalls, load balancers, and VPNs, to provide advanced networking capabilities.

Another important feature of NSX is its ability to provide micro-segmentation capabilities. Micro-segmentation allows administrators to create fine-grained security policies for virtual machines, which reduces the attack surface and improves security posture. This can be achieved by creating security groups, and applying security policies to them.

NSX also allows users to automate network provisioning and management. Users can create network templates and use them to automatically provision new virtual networks, or make changes to existing ones. This can greatly reduce the time and effort required to manage and maintain virtual networks.

In addition, NSX provides a comprehensive set of monitoring and troubleshooting tools to help administrators understand how their virtual networks are performing and where issues may be occurring. These tools provide real-time visibility into network traffic and usage, as well as the ability to drill down into specific virtual machines or network segments to identify and resolve issues.

Overall, NSX is a powerful network virtualization platform that allows users to create and manage virtual networks, improve security posture, automate network provisioning and management and troubleshoot network issues. With its advanced features and management tools, NSX is an essential tool for any organization looking to improve their network virtualization capabilities.

Within a VMware Cloud solution, NSX is utilized to allow for these overlay segments to create networks that will work for your workloads, no matter if they are on-premises or in the cloud.


vSAN

The third and final functional component of VMware Cloud is vSAN. VMware vSAN is a software-defined storage platform from VMware that allows users to create and manage a shared storage pool for virtual machines. This platform is designed to provide a simple, efficient, and cost-effective way to manage storage for virtualized environments.

One of the key features of vSAN is the ability to create a shared storage pool from the local storage resources of multiple ESXi hosts. This allows users to create a highly available and scalable storage infrastructure, without the need for expensive external storage devices. vSAN also allows users to create storage policies that can be applied to virtual machines, to ensure that they have the storage resources they need to perform optimally.

Another important feature of vSAN is its ability to provide advanced data services, such as snapshots, clones, and replication. These services allow users to easily create point-in-time copies of virtual machines, and use them for testing, development, or disaster recovery. vSAN also supports storage-efficient snapshots and clones, which use space-efficient techniques like deduplication, compression, and thin provisioning to minimize the storage space required.

vSAN also provides a centralized management and monitoring console, which allows users to monitor and manage their storage infrastructure. The console provides real-time visibility into storage capacity, usage, and performance, as well as the ability to drill down into specific virtual machines or storage objects to identify and resolve issues. vSAN also integrates with vCenter Server, which allows administrators to manage both compute and storage resources from a single console.

Overall, VMware vSAN is a powerful software-defined storage platform that allows users to create and manage a shared storage pool for virtual machines. It provides advanced data services, centralized management and monitoring, and integrates with vCenter server. With its advanced features and management tools, vSAN is an essential tool for any organization looking to improve their storage management capabilities in a virtualized environment.


Combining vSphere, NSX, and vSAN into VMware Cloud

By combining these functional components, VMware Cloud allows businesses to easily create and manage a virtualized IT infrastructure that is highly secure, resilient, and scalable. This can help businesses to reduce costs, improve performance, and increase agility, while also providing them with the tools and features they need to manage and scale their IT infrastructure as their business grows.

Like to learn more about this topic?
Join our upcoming webinar where Frazier will speak on: Essential Cloud Capabilities: 3 skills you must master when migrating to the Cloud

In a world where innovation is happening at the speed of light, it’s hard to keep up. One day you’re a tech wizard and the next you’re outdated. Join us for an interactive session where you will learn the 3 skills you must master when migrating to the Cloud.  Earn the admiration of your fellow technology leaders by launching your next project successfully. After this webinar, you will be able to discuss the benefits of moving from on prem to the cloud and avoid many of the common migration pitfalls. Register today!